Job Overview As a Data Entry Analyst at Jobtrix, you will play a critical role in ensuring the accuracy, completeness, and quality of our data. You will be responsible for monitoring and updating data in a timely manner, identifying gaps and inconsistencies, and collaborating with cross-functional teams to address data-related issues. Key Responsibilities Utilize Excel and Salesforce to monitor and update data in a timely and efficient manner, ensuring all fields and records are complete and meet required standards. Identify gaps, inconsistencies, or missing data within the system and ensure timely follow-up for correction, collaborating with relevant teams as needed. Conduct regular data validation checks to identify inaccuracies or discrepancies in lead information, preparing reports detailing missing or incomplete data and communicating these findings to the sales team. Collaborate closely with the Sales Team to address missing data and ensure that leads are properly qualified, providing necessary updates and follow-up to ensure data is being corrected or qualified based on the information provided. Proactively suggest improvements to current data handling practices to enhance the overall quality and efficiency of data management, working within guidelines and tools to streamline data quality processes and reduce operational costs. Follow established guidelines and workflows to ensure consistency in data entry and reporting, documenting and reporting any challenges or deviations from standard processes to leadership for further action. Essential Qualifications Proven experience in data entry, or a related field, with a strong understanding of data quality principles and practices. Strong proficiency with Excel (formulas, pivot tables, data analysis) and experience working with Salesforce, or similar CRM systems.
